Make a Real Difference

Are you an experienced Clinical Lead, Senior Complex Care Practitioner, Registered Nurse or Healthcare Professional looking for a rewarding leadership role supporting young people with profound and complex needs? We are recruiting for a newly created Clinical Lead Complex Care position within a specialist SEND setting opening in September 2026. This is a unique opportunity to shape clinical support services within a purpose-built environment designed to support learners with severe learning difficulties, complex medical needs and physical disabilities. This role would suit someone passionate about improving outcomes for young people whilst providing leadership, training and clinical oversight to support staff.

About the Role

As Clinical Lead, you will take responsibility for overseeing the medical and care needs of learners with complex health requirements. You will work closely with families, therapists, medical professionals, educators and support staff to ensure learners receive safe, person-centred and effective care throughout their educational journey. You will also lead on staff training, care planning, risk assessments and clinical governance across the service.
